What is the relationship between political cartoons and the Fugitive Slave Act?

Political cartoons played a significant role in highlighting the problems with the Fugitive Slave Act. They used humor, exaggeration, and symbolism to make people think about the act's implications and the need for reform. Many of these cartoons became influential in shaping public opinion against the act.

Political cartoons often depicted the injustice and cruelty of the Fugitive Slave Act, using satire and imagery to raise public awareness and opposition.

Tell some real stories related to the Fugitive Slave Act.

There was a case where a family of escaped slaves had made a new life in a northern state. However, the Fugitive Slave Act allowed slave catchers to come after them. The community tried to protect them, but the law was on the side of the slave owners. The family had to go into hiding and live in constant fear of being discovered and sent back to the brutal life of slavery.

What are some lesser - known real stories of the Fugitive Slave Act?

One such story is about a young boy who was born free in a northern town. Due to his dark skin, he was wrongly accused of being a fugitive slave. The Fugitive Slave Act made it possible for his accusers to take him into custody without much evidence. His family had to fight a long legal battle to prove his freedom.
